Tolerances do not match specification.

If you are having trouble replacing a clutch master cylinder on a 1998-2002 Honda Accord then you will understand the problems associated with accessing the clutch MC. There is very little room between the firewall, brake booster and rack post to use one hand, let alone two, to disconnect and reconnect the MC hardline, which is held in place with just one clamp.
